SUPERBIKES - Delves hopes to carry momentum into Cadwell Park over bank holiday weekend

LIAM Delves travels east to Cadwell Park in the Lincolnshire Wolds for the seventh round of the Bennetts British Superbike championship which takes place over the bank holiday weekend.

The 21-year-old rookie recorded his highest finish of the season last time at Thruxton as he placed 19th to break into the top-20 positions for the first time.

Riding the Rapid Training Rapid CDH Racing Kawasaki Fuelled by Cheshire Mouldings and Woodturnings Ltd the Solihull rider is relishing the thought of flying over the notorious mountain section of the course for the first time on a powerful superbike.

The Cadwell Park round is now back to its original slot over the August Bank Holiday and attracts a huge following for the Party in the Park which produces some fast and exciting racing.




And the action begins on Saturday with free practice and continues into Sunday with qualifying plus the Sprint race with the two main races taking place on Monday.

Timetable

Saturday – Free practice (11am and 3pm)


Sunday – Free practice (10.20am and 1.10pm), Qualifying (1.30pm), Sprint race 14 laps (4.30pm)

Monday – Warm-up (9.55am), race two 18 laps (1.30pm), race three 18 laps (4.30pm)
